THE ORE-PROSPECTING SIGNIFICANCE OF AEROMANGETIC ANOMALIES OVER THE QUATERNARY COVER AREA IN ANSHAN,LIAONING PROVINCE

Abstract
According to the present situation of iron and steel industry in China,this paper has discussed the significance of aeromagnetic anomalies in iron ore exploration.These aeromagnetic anomalies are distributed in Quaternary cover area.Through aeromagnetic data processing,the authors put forward an opinion that the positive vertical quadratic derivative region can be used as a factor for discussing the distribution regularities of ore deposits.Aeromagnetic data and other data such as Bouguer anomaly data and geological map data are also discussed.It is considered that these aeromagnetic anomalies can be used in prospecting for iron deposits and that there exist a lot of iron deposits there.
